Output 8975c3a5ad7b663f58dda449b015bcc8d5c2ca7b0d49b5a639c067c78866fd06:21

value
62014483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4556de27a5106c004fd9191e346be1968820d33 OP_EQUAL
address
3M3jWwRtwB22Tm3BTnn34AzUnuEPgwDK7m
transaction
8975c3a5ad7b663f58dda449b015bcc8d5c2ca7b0d49b5a639c067c78866fd06
confirmations
471673
spent
true